Makdoompur is a village situated in Sambhal tehsil of Moradabad district in Uttar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 148 families residing in the village Makdoompur. The total population of Makdoompur is 965 out of which 505 are males and 460 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Makdoompur is 911.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Makdoompur village is 224 which is 23% of the total population. There are 112 male children and 112 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Makdoompur is 1,000 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(911) of Makdoompur village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Makdoompur is 39%. Thus Makdoompur village has a lower literacy rate compared to 47.4% of Moradabad district. The male literacy rate is 49.11% and the female literacy rate is 27.59% in Makdoompur village.

Working Population as per Census 2011

In Makdoompur village out of total population, 249 were engaged in work activities. 97.6%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 2.4%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 249 workers engaged in Main Work, 49 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 62 were Agricultural labourers.
